Abstract
The invention relates to a self-cleaning oven and a cleaning method thereof, wherein the self-cleaning oven comprises: the food storage box comprises a box body, wherein a cavity for placing food is arranged in the box body; the steam release device is used for releasing high-temperature steam into the cavity and melting oil stains on the inner wall of the cavity; the multi-angle spray head is used for spraying cleaning liquid on the top surface, the bottom surface and the side surfaces of the cavity. Before the multi-angle spray head sprays cleaning liquid, the oil stain is firstly melted by high-temperature steam, so that stains can be easily cleaned when the cleaning liquid is sprayed. And adopt multi-angle shower nozzle can all clear up the top surface, bottom surface and the side of cavity, improve clean effect. The operation convenience is improved without wiping by a user in the whole process.

Background
When the oven is used, a high-temperature environment can be manufactured in the inner container cavity, and food can be quickly cooked by using high temperature. Generally, food baked in an oven has large grease, and under a high-temperature environment, the grease can float and contaminate the top, side walls and bottom wall of an inner container of the oven. And the greasy dirt attached to the inner wall is difficult to clean, so that the cleaning difficulty is high on one hand and the cleaning effect is poor on the other hand when a user manually wipes the inner wall. In the past, bacteria are easy to breed in the oven, and the food sanitation problem is caused.

As shown in fig. 1 and 2, in one embodiment, there is provided a self-cleaning oven 10 comprising:
the food box comprises a box body 11, wherein a cavity 111 for placing food is arranged in the box body 11;
the steam release device is used for releasing high-temperature steam into the cavity 111 and melting oil stains on the inner wall of the cavity 111;
and a multi-angle spray head 13 for spraying a cleaning liquid on the top, bottom and side surfaces of the chamber 111.
According to the self-cleaning oven 10 provided by the scheme, when cleaning is needed, the steam release device operates to release high-temperature steam into the cavity 111, oil stains on the inner wall of the cavity 111 are melted, then the multi-angle spray head 13 operates to spray cleaning liquid on the top surface, the bottom surface and the side surfaces of the cavity 111, and stains on the inner wall of the cavity 111 are cleaned. Before the multi-angle spray head 13 sprays the cleaning liquid, the oil stain is firstly melted by high-temperature steam, so that the stain can be easily cleaned when the cleaning liquid is sprayed. And for general spray arm, adopt multi-angle shower nozzle 13 can all clear up the top surface, bottom surface and the side of cavity 111, improve clean effect. In the whole process, a user does not need to wipe the inner wall of the cavity 111, so that the operation convenience is improved.
In particular, the steam release device may be combined with a water containing device to form a device capable of producing steam by means of a heating element that provides a high temperature environment when cooking in an oven. Or other devices capable of forming vapor may be directly used without particular limitation.
As shown in fig. 3, the multi-angle spray head 13 includes a plurality of nozzles, each of which has a different spray angle, and the plurality of nozzles are spatially distributed in a spherical shape, so that the multi-angle spray head 13 can spray the cleaning liquid onto the top, bottom, and side surfaces of the chamber 111.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 3, in one embodiment, the multi-angle nozzle 13 includes a nozzle portion having a spherical shape, and the nozzle portion is provided with a plurality of nozzles spaced along a spherical surface of the nozzle portion.
Further, in one emb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 to 4, a water pipe 15 is disposed on the multi-angle spray head 13 for conveying the cleaning liquid into the multi-angle spray head 13. Specifically, when the multi-angle spray head 13 includes the spray head portion, the water pipe 15 is communicated with the spray head portion for conveying the cleaning liquid into the multi-angle spray head 13. The cleaning liquid can be clear water or liquid mixed with detergent.
As shown in FIG. 2, the self-cleaning oven 10 also includes a rotary drive assembly 14. As shown in fig. 1, an engaging member 151 is provided outside the water pipe 15, and the rotation driving assembly 14 is engaged with the engaging member 151 to drive the multi-angle nozzle 13 to rotate around the water pipe 15 as a rotation axis.
Therefore, in the using process, the multi-angle spray head 13 not only sprays the cleaning liquid on the inner wall of the cavity 111 by virtue of the shape characteristics of the multi-angle spray head, but also can rotate by virtue of the rotary driving component 14, so that the sprayed cleaning liquid has higher power, the coverage area and uniformity of spraying are further improved, and the cleaning effect is improved.
Specifically, the multi-angle spray head 13 may be disposed on a top wall, a bottom wall, or a side wall of the case 11.
Further, as shown in fig. 1-4, in one embodiment, the rotary drive assembly 14 includes a rotary drive 141 and a transmission 142. The transmission member 142 is connected to the rotating shaft of the rotating driving member 141, and the rotating driving member 141 drives the transmission member 142 to rotate when operating. In particular, the rotary driving element 141 may be a motor, and the transmission element 142 may be a gear. The engagement member 151 may be a gear. The water pipe 15 penetrates through the top wall of the box body 11, and the multi-angle spray head 13 is positioned in the cavity 111. In other words, the multi-angle spray head 13 is connected with the top wall of the box body 11 through the water delivery pipe 15. The water pipe 15 and the top wall may be connected by a bearing, so that the water pipe 15 can rotate. The rotary driving member 141 and the transmission member 142 are located above the top wall, and the transmission member 142 is engaged with the engaging member 151. When the rotary driving member 141 is operated, the transmission member 142 rotates to drive the engaging member 151 engaged therewith to rotate, so that the multi-angle nozzle 13 rotates with the water pipe 15 as a rotating shaft.
Further specifically, as shown in fig. 3, in one embodiment, a portion of the water pipe 15 near the multi-angle spraying head 13 is a rotating section 152, the rotating section 152 is communicated with other pipe sections of the water pipe 15, the rotating section 152 is rotatable with the other pipe sections of the water pipe 15, and the engaging member 151 is disposed outside the rotating section 152. So that when the rotational driving assembly 14 is operated, the engaging member 151 rotates with the rotation section 152, and the rotation section 152 rotates with the multiple angle spray head 13. At this time, the multi-angle spray head 13 rotates about the axis of the rotation section 152.
When the rotary drive assembly 14 comprises a rotary drive element 141 and a transmission element 142, the transmission element 142 cooperates with an engagement element 151 arranged outside the rotary segment 152. The rotary section 152 penetrates the top wall of the case 11.
Optionally, the water pipe 15 may also be a hose, and the flexibility of the hose is utilized to meet the yielding requirement in the rotating process.
Further, as shown in fig. 1 to 4, in one embodiment, the self-cleaning oven 10 further includes a pressurized water pump 16, a water purifying box 17 is disposed on the bottom wall of the box body 11, the water purifying box 17 can be drawn out of the box body 11, the water pipe 15 is communicated with the water purifying box 17, and the pressurized water pump 16 is communicated with the water pipe 15 for pumping the water in the water purifying box 17 to the multi-angle nozzle 13.
When cleaning the inner wall of the cavity 111, the pressurized water pump 16 pumps the water in the water purifying box 17 to the multi-angle nozzle 13. And the user only needs to draw out the water purifying box 17 and add water into the water purifying box, so that the operation is simple and convenient. Specifically, the user may add detergent to the clean water cartridge 17 to enhance the cleaning effect.
Further specifically, in one emb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 and 2, the bottom wall of the tank 11 is provided with a clean water drawer tank 112, an opening of the clean water drawer tank 112 is located at a front side surface of the tank 11, the clean water cartridge 17 is located in the clean water drawer tank 112, and the clean water cartridge 17 can be drawn out of the tank 11 through the opening of the clean water drawer tank 112, thereby improving convenience of operation.
In order to ensure that the purified water cartridge 17 is inserted into the purified water drawer slot 112, the water pipe 15 can be communicated with the purified water cartridge 17 by drawing out or inserting the purified water cartridge 17 from the front side into the tank 11, so that the subsequent cleaning process can be smoothly performed.
In one embodiment, the part of the water pipe 15 close to the water purifying cartridge 17 is an introduction section. The leading-in section is a flexible hose, and a containing space for containing the flexible hose is arranged at a position on the box body 11 corresponding to the flexible hose, and the flexible hose can move along with the movement of the water purifying box 17. So that the flexible hose follows the movement as the purified water cartridge 17 moves back and forth in the purified water drawer tub 112 to be always communicated with the purified water cartridge 17. For example, the introduction section extends through a side wall of the water purification cartridge 17 remote from the front side surface and communicates with the water purification cartridge 17.
Alternatively, in one embodiment, the introduction section is a telescopic tube, and the telescopic direction of the telescopic tube is the moving direction of the purified water box 17 in the purified water drawer groove 112. So that the introduction section is extended and contracted with the movement of the purified water cartridge 17, so that the introduction section can be always communicated with the purified water cartridge 17, and the water in the purified water cartridge 17 can be surely pumped out from the water pipe 15.
Further, in one emb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 and 4, a diversion trench and a drainage hole 116 are formed on the bottom surface of the cavity 111, a detachable sewage box 18 is formed on the bottom wall of the tank body 11, and the drainage hole 116 is communicated between the diversion trench and the sewage box 18.
When the steam release device and the multi-angle nozzle 13 operate in sequence, and the stain on the inner wall of the cavity 111 is washed and fallen, the stain is gathered in the diversion trench along with the water flow, and then flows into the sewage box 18 from the drain hole 116. The user simply pours the sewage in the sewage box 18.
During the cleaning process of the self-cleaning oven 10, the user needs to perform an operation of putting clean water or clean water mixed with detergent into the clean water box 17 and then pouring the sewage in the sewage box 18. The operation is convenient, the user time is saved, and the user experience is improved.
Specifically, in one embodiment, as shown in fig. 1, 2 and 4, the guide grooves include an annular groove 114 and a confluence groove 115, the annular groove 114 is disposed at the middle of the bottom surface, and the drain holes 116 are disposed in a longitudinal direction. The sewage box 18 and the purified water box 17 are arranged side by side at intervals, the bottom end of the drain hole 116 is communicated with the purified water box 17, and the confluence groove 115 is communicated between the annular groove 114 and the drain hole 116.
After the cleaning liquid sprayed by the multi-angle spray head 13 cleans up the stains, the stains are gathered to the bottom surface of the cavity 111 along the water flow, and then flow into the sewage box 18 along the annular groove 114, the converging groove 115 and the drainage hole 116 in sequence. Based on the sewage box 18 and the purified water box 17 arranged side by side at intervals, the sewage box 18 is not located in the middle of the bottom wall of the box body 11, and therefore the converging groove 115 is arranged to drain away the dirt gathered in the annular groove 114.
Further, in one embodiment, the annular grooves 114 are multiple, the radius of each annular groove 114 is different, the annular grooves 114 are concentrically arranged at intervals, and the confluence groove 115 is communicated with each annular groove 114. Improve the collection effect of the stains, thereby improving the cleaning effect.
Further, as shown in fig. 1, 2 and 4, in one embodiment, a bottom wall of the box body 11 is provided with a sewage drawer groove 113, an opening of the sewage drawer groove 113 is located at a front side surface of the box body 11, the sewage box 18 is located in the sewage drawer groove 113, and the sewage box 18 can be drawn out of the box body 11 through the opening of the sewage drawer groove 113. The user can operate the fresh water cartridge 17 and the foul water cartridge 18 at the front of the housing 11.
Further, as shown in fig. 2, in an embodiment, the oven further includes a door 12, a cavity opening is disposed on a front side of the oven body 11, and the door 12 closes or opens the cavity opening by opening and closing. And the door 12 may shield the opening of the clean water drawer tank 112 and the opening of the dirty water drawer tank 113 on the front side. When the operation of the sewage box 18 or the purified water box 17 is required, the box door 12 is opened.
Alternatively, a relief port is provided at a position of the box door 12 corresponding to the opening of the sewage drawer tank 113 and the opening of the purified water drawer tank 112. The operation of the fresh water cartridge 17 or the foul water cartridge 18 can be performed without opening the tank door 12.
Further, in another embodiment, there is provided a method of cleaning a self-cleaning oven 10, the self-cleaning oven 10 being the self-cleaning oven 10 described above, the method of cleaning a self-cleaning oven 10 comprising the steps of:
the steam releasing device is started to release high-temperature steam into the cavity 111 of the box body 11;
after the oil stain on the inner wall of the cavity 111 is melted by the high-temperature steam, the multi-angle spray head 13 intermittently sprays water.
According to the scheme, the method for cleaning the self-cleaning oven 10 is provided, and in the cleaning process, oil stains are firstly melted by high-temperature steam, so that stains can be easily cleaned when cleaning liquid is sprayed. And adopt multi-angle shower nozzle 13 can all clear up the top surface, bottom surface and the side of cavity 111 to effectively improve clean effect. In addition, the user does not need to wipe the inner wall of the cavity 111 in the whole process, and the operation convenience is improved.
Further, after the multi-angle spraying nozzle 13 sprays water, the self-cleaning oven 10 enters a drying stage to dry the water in the cavity 111.
